ACI enters Indian real estate market

ACI Real Estate, an associate of German investment company Alternative Capital Invest GmbH, on 9th April entered the Indian real estate market through its franchisee, Hyderabad based Global Properties.

This marks the initial phase of ACI’s Indian franchisee network, which is being launched to serve the firm’s real estate portfolio in the UAE, at present valued at more than Dh10 billion.

The company has pronounced that in the upcoming months it will continue to seek prime franchisee operators to represent it across key Indian cities. Its portfolio includes residential, commercial, leisure and retail developments in prime locations in Dubai, Abu Dhabi, Ajman and other emerging cities across the UAE.

Talking on the potential of the franchisee set up, Sanjay Chimnani, joint managing director of ACI Real Estate, said: “The agreement with Global Properties marks our first coalition in India to serve the quickly rising investor market. In selecting our local franchisee, we found Global Properties who share our mission of doing business with clearness, purpose and truthfulness. We believe the ACI franchisee network in India will set a suitable gateway that links the astute Indian investor with ACI’s vast UAE property portfolio.”

ACI Real Estate’s projects in Dubai include premium branded properties such as the Sports Trilogy project comprising the Michael Schumacher, Boris Becker and Niki Lauda towers. Its developments also include the Dh6bn Marine Legends with the Ferretti Group.
